Kiehl's Pure Vitality Skin Renewing Cream, 50ml for R 895.
"The new moisturiser from Kiehl’s contains red ginsing root and Manuka honey, and the jar promises visible renewal for smoother texture and healthy radiance. I have been searching for a moisturiser that is rich enough for my dry skin and I have finally met my match.
"This cream looks like something you want to eat. It has the texture of buttered honey and is thick and nourishing. So much so that I wouldn’t recommended it to people prone to breakouts or clogged pores. This is a heavy duty moisturiser that will smooth and feed even the most crêpe-like skin.
"Although it isn’t indicated for it, I have applied it to my eczema patches and it has worked a treat. I would definitely use it as a night cream though, or only during the day if you are not planning to wear base, as it doesn’t make a great foundation for makeup." - Lili Radloff

Exfoliate the easy way
Skinderm pure exfoliating glo pad, R395 for 30, get it at Perfect 10 salons.
Good for easy exfoliation to remove dry, dull, lacklustre skin cells. You glide two at a time over your face and neck. It contains glycolic acid (AHA) and salicylic acid (BHA) - the AHA will exfoliate the surface of your skin and the BHA reaches within your pores.
